Stage 1: Thick Epoxy Pour
Two male workers begin the project.
Left side: Pink thick epoxy is poured onto half of the floor.
Right side: Blue thick epoxy is poured onto the other half.
The floor is clearly divided into two bold colors.
Stage 2: Spreading & Leveling
Both workers use floor scrapers to evenly spread the epoxy across their respective halves, creating a smooth and glossy surface with a sharp center division.
Stage 3: Shape Marking
A large heart shape is marked on the pink side.
A large star shape is marked on the blue side.
Precise outlines are drawn before cutting.
Stage 4: Excavation
Using tools, both shapes are dug approximately 1.5 feet deep.
The heart and star cavities are cleaned and prepared for artistic detailing.
Stage 5: Artistic Design
Pink side: Detailed pink and white floral epoxy artwork is created inside the heart.
Blue side: A realistic ocean scene with underwater elements is designed inside the star.
Stage 6: Transparent Epoxy Seal
Thick clear epoxy is poured into both shapes, fully sealing the designs beneath a deep glass-like finish.
Stage 7: Furniture Setup
Blue furniture is arranged on the ocean-themed side.
Pink furniture is arranged on the floral-themed side.
The room transforms into a perfect dual-theme interior.
